摘要:
This paper presents the report of investigations ona prioriapodization of the pupil of a telescope operating in a turbulent medium. The criterion of apodization has been taken to be the maximization of the factor of encircled energy on a pre-specified area on the far-field plane. It has been observed that the optimum pupil function designed on the basis of a perfectly space-coherent wave being incident on the pupil has got to be modified by a small but significant amount to obtain the optimum function when a partially space-coherent wave is incident on the same. This leads to the possibility of using turbulence-corrector pupils in conjunction with the optimum pupil function designed for the coherent case to achieve an overall apodization. Numerical results are presented.
